What is an SE manager?

SE Managers, or Systems Engineering Managers, are professionals who oversee teams of systems engineers responsible for designing, implementing, and maintaining complex technical systems. They bridge the gap between technical teams and business objectives, ensuring projects are completed efficiently and meet organizational standards. SE Managers also coordinate resources, manage timelines, and provide technical guidance to their teams. They often collaborate with other departments to ensure smooth integration of systems and technologies.

How does an SE manager typically support and develop their sales engineering team for optimal performance?

A SE (Sales Engineering) Manager plays a key role in coaching, mentoring, and supporting their team of sales engineers. This includes conducting regular one-on-one meetings, providing feedback on technical presentations, and facilitating training on new products or solutions. SE Managers often collaborate closely with both sales and product teams to ensure sales engineers have the resources and knowledge needed to address client needs. They also help prioritize workloads, remove obstacles, and promote professional development through certifications or workshops, which collectively contribute to both individual and team success.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an SE man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a SE Manager, you need a solid background in technical sales, solution design, and leadership, often supported by a degree in engineering or a related field and experience in sales engineering roles. Familiarity with CRM platforms, sales enablement tools, and industry-specific software is typically expected, along with certifications such as AWS Certified Solutions Architect or similar. Outstanding communication, team management, and problem-solving abilities help SE Managers guide their teams and build strong client relationships. These skills are critical for aligning technical solutions with customer needs and driving sales success in competitive markets.

Job description

Job Summary
General Atomics (GA), and its affiliated companies, is one of the world's leading resources for high-technology systems development ranging from the nuclear fuel cycle to remotely piloted aircraft, airborne sensors, and advanced electric, electronic, wireless and laser technologies.
General Atomics Electromagnetic Systems (GA-EMS) designs and manufactures first-of-a-kind electromagnetic and electric power generation systems. GA-EMS' expanding portfolio of specialized products and integrated system solutions support critical fleet, space systems and satellites, missile defense, power and energy, and process and monitoring applications for defense, industrial, and commercial customers worldwide.
We currently have an exciting opportunity in our Systems Engineering Integration department for a full-time Systems Engineer (SE) Manager with a background in space to join our team located in San Diego, CA
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
Planning and Collaboration
  • Participate in the preparation of proposals, business plans, proposal work statements and specifications, operating budgets and financial terms/conditions of contract(s).
  • Team with Program/Project/Proposal Management and Design Engineering to build consensus-driven solutions and execution plans for new and existing programs.
  • Coordinate all engineering work, assignments, and inputs to support the project Integrated Master Schedule (IMS) and budget aligned with the Project Management Plan (PMP) for multiple business areas.
  • Assign individual contributors and leads to projects and ensures appropriate processes and practices are followed.
  • Assist in the management and execution of project plans, in concert with project leadership.
  • Partner with business leaders, and control account managers to keep engineering manpower forecasts up to date.
  • Own engineering scope, budget, schedule, and performance to meet program objectives.
  • Partner closely with program leadership to proactively plan, resource, and level-load work, resolving resource constraints and keeping projects on track.
Execution and Coordination
  • Provide direct program support in the role of a Lead Systems Engineer or as an Individual Contributor to support program timelines and deliverables across various space and airborne payload programs, laser systems, optical communication terminal systems, and other prototype systems, throughout the design, development, integration, and test phases of the product life-cycle.
  • May also support Systems Engineering across other GA products such as tactical missiles, projectiles, radiation monitoring systems, complex aerospace systems, internal development projects, and new business opportunities as needed.
  • Help define and shape the roles, responsibilities, and core processes for an emerging Systems Engineering team.
  • Drive day-to-day task prioritization to meet schedule and program needs while overseeing and ensuring the quality of work produced by the team.
  • Supervise and ensure staff execution to conform to cost, schedule, production, and performance commitments.
  • Leads the engineering team to common objectives, clearly communicates the status of efforts, identify/resolve issues, and manages to cost/schedule.
  • Own the execution and proper implementation of system engineering processes across design, development, integration, test and performance verification.
  • Manages resource needs and leads system engineering activities across multiple programs, as well as from the extended engineering organization when surge support is necessary to support schedule.
  • Provide leadership and direct all activities of the group including planning and managing technical performance to ensure quality, business and financial objectives are attained.
Status and Communication
  • Regularly gather status from engineering team and provides the status and updates to the Engineering Management and Senior Leadership.
  • Represents the engineering functional organization to Project Management providing status, coordination, and collaboration in achieving project objectives and timelines.
  • Represent specific project team's efforts to the engineering functional organization and Project Managers.
Growth and Continual Improvement
  • Identify and implement process improvements centered on company systems engineering processes, product lifecycle best practices, and functional manager best practices.
  • Ensure technical leadership and excellence is maintained by participating in the planning, attraction, selection, retention, and development of the required technical talent.
  • Participate in the preparation of proposals, business plans, proposal work statements and specifications, operating budgets, and financial terms/conditions of contract(s).
  • Responsible for ensuring all laws, regulations and other applicable obligations are observed wherever and whenever business is conducted on behalf of the Company.
  • Responsible for ensuring work is accomplished in a safe manner in accordance with established operating procedures and practices.

Job Qualifications
  • Typically requires a Bachelors, Masters or PhD in engineering or a related technical field as well as eleven or more years of progressively complex engineering experience. May substitute equivalent experience in lieu of education.
  • Experienced system engineering leader that has lead the development, assembly, integration and testing for systems slated to undergo verification and validation including creation of system engineering and test artifacts for space or airborne payloads.
  • Experienced in leading teams through the preparation and execution of program milestone reviews such as system requirements review (SRR), system functional review (SFR), preliminary & critical design review (PDR, CDR), test readiness review (TRR), and customer acceptance review (AR).
  • Demonstrates an extensive technical expertise and application of engineering principles, concepts, theory, and practice as well as project management and leadership skills including organizing, planning, scheduling, and coordinating workloads to meet established deadlines or milestones.
  • Must demonstrate the ability to resolve managerial, technical, and interpersonal challenges.
  • Knowledgeable and experienced with Requirements Management applications (DOORS, JAMA, etc.), requirements development, and product lifecycle planning and integration for complex systems are required.
  • Strong communication, leadership, presentation, and interpersonal skills are required to enable an effective interface with other departments, all levels of management, professional and support staff, customers, potential customers, and government representatives.
  • Customer focused, must be able to work on a self-initiated basis and in a team environment, and able to work extended hours and travel as required.
  • A Professional Engineering License, and original work(s) published in professional engineering journals are desirable.
  • The ability to obtain and maintain a top-secret DOD or DOE-Q clearance is required.
Desired Qualifications:
  • Knowledge of SysML and model based system engineering (MBSE) with experience developing multiple SysML diagram models.
  • Requires strong skills in management, project management, leadership, communication, systems engineering, and engineering technical disciplines.
  • Education and/or work experience in firmware and software engineering development.
  • Broad, multi-disciplinary technical expertise and a history of applying of engineering principles, concepts, theory, and practice
  • Demonstrated experience leading multi-disciplinary, product-oriented engineering teams.
  • Demonstrated success in aligning procedure and processes to improve team throughput and visibility.
  • Experience writing technical documents and computer literate with versatile knowledge of the computer applications and MRP systems used in the industry (MS Word, Excel, Access, Project, SAP, Windchill, etc.).
  • Demonstrated knowledge and implementation of best practices to help transitions from design development to sustainment.
  • Expertise or significant experience in systems engineering, industrial process engineering, nuclear engineering, or mechanical engineering.
  • Existing Security Clearance preferred (DOE-Q or DOD -Secret)
